Aha, digital streaming app founded by Allu Aravind has projected itself as the exclusive Telugu digital content platform. However the app didn’t live upto its expectations till date. While the movies acquired by this platform are quite less, exclusive content and originals are termed quite mediocre by the audiences. Except 1 or 2, no show has got positive response.
So Allu Aravind has changed his strategy and reduced producing web series content. He is now concentrating more on acquiring more Telugu movies. Amid huge competition, Aha app has now made superb deal. It has acquired the digital rights of Naga Chaitanya’s upcoming romantic entertainer Love Story. The digital rights were purchased for a whopping 6 Cr rupees.
Sekhar Kammula is directing the film while Sai Pallavi is the female lead. Love Story is carrying good buzz with its first single being a massive hit. Few days of shoot is still left to be canned. Makers are thinking to release the film later this year. Asian Cinemas is venturing into production with this movie. Allu Aravind is now planning to buy more interesting movies.
